''The Silent Lover'' is a 1926 American silent
adventure film The adventure film is a broad genre of film. Some early genre studies found it no different than the Western film or argued that adventure could encompass all Hollywood genres. Commonality was found among historians Brian Taves and Ian Cameron in ...
directed by George Archainbaud and starring Milton Sills, Natalie Kingston and Viola Dana.
